End Credits
-- 6th Season (1996-1997)
(Special thanks to "Whiggles".)
Special Note:
For all practicality, numbers given here are according to production order,
and are as follows:
66: Chanukah
67: Mother's Day
68: Vacation
69: Spike's Babies / Chicken Pops
70: Radio Daze / Psycho Angelica
71: America's Wackiest Home Movies / The 'Lympics
72: The Carwash / Heatwave
73: Faire Play / The Smell of Success
74: Angelica's Last Stand / Clan of the Duck
75: The Turkey Who Came To Dinner
76: Potty Training Spike / The Art Fair
77: Send In The Clouds / In The Navel
78: The Mattress / Looking For Jack
79: Hiccups / Autumn Leaves
80: Dust Bunnies / Educating Angelica
Also, note that some 1997 episodes are missing from this list, while "Hiccups
/ Autumn Leaves", a 1998 episode, is listed. This order and season arrangement
reflects the production order, not the actual order of initial broadcast
on Nick US or YTV. For the Nick US order, see the brief
episode list.
